I think it's best to also Reboot the system in Selective Startup Run Selective Startup using System Configuration and run http://www.sevenforums.com/tutorials/1538-sfc-scannow-command-system-file-checker.html
Also test it in a new Windows Profile
- Open User Accounts by clicking the Start button , clicking Control Panel, clicking User Accounts and Family Safety (or clicking User Accounts, if you are connected to a network domain), and then clicking User Accounts.
- Click Manage another account. If you are prompted for an administrator password or confirmation, type the password or provide confirmation.
- Click Create a new account.
- Type the name you want to give the user account, click an account type, and then click Create Account.
